By now, everyone is aware of the fact that Brock Lesnar pushed Daniel Cormier at UFC 226, setting up a potential fight against the UFC Heavyweight and Light Heavyweight Champion when he returns to the Octagon in early 2019.
During a recent interview with the folks at Instinct Culture, the UFC “Champ-Champ” joked about the fact that Lesnar may have pushed him because he knows he is friends with another WWE Superstar, “The Architect” Seth Rollins.
“Maybe that’s why [Lesnar’s] mad at me because I’m friends with Seth Rollins,” Cormier told Instinct Culture. “I got a text message from Seth right after the fight. He goes, ‘congratulations now go kick Brock’s ass,'” D.C. revealed.
“That’s what I’m gonna do,” he added.”
